Webb12 dec. 2024 · To do a fuzzy search use the tilde, "~", symbol at the end of a single word / term you want to search with fuzziness. For example to search for a term similar in spelling to " roam " use the fuzzy search: roam~. This search will find terms like foam and roams. similar~ words~ would find not only similar words but similer works, too because both ...
